Pitch Report & Venue Stats

The surface at The Rose Bowl has heavily favored the slower bowlers in recent outings. Across the last five matches here, the average first innings score sits at a modest 153 runs. More importantly, spinners have dictated the middle overs, claiming 32 wickets compared to just 26 wickets by the pacers. The square boundaries are relatively expansive, forcing batters to rely on hard running rather than easy maximums.

Key Players to Watch

  • Orla Prendergast: The undisputed engine of the Irish lineup. She has amassed 59 runs and taken 2 wickets in this series, averaging a massive 112 fantasy points. Her medium pace is highly effective in the powerplay.
  • Amelia Kerr: Despite a quiet start with the ball, her leg spin is tailor made for the gripping surface at The Rose Bowl. She has already scored 50 runs and remains a premium captaincy option.
  • Sophie Devine: The veteran all rounder has top scored for her side with 67 runs so far. If she finds her groove, she can single handedly dismantle the Irish bowling attack.
  • Aimee Maguire: A brilliant differential. Her slow left arm spin has already netted her 3 wickets in the tournament, and she will exploit the favorable venue conditions perfectly.
